Moki the Warrior

Most small dogs I work with have big attitude.  If they didn't, their owners wouldn't be sending them off to the dog park.  Moki isn't shy on attitude, but with two much bigger dogs in his household, he often appears to be the quiet third wheel.  This couldn't be further from the truth however.  He is entirely the instigator of most of the mayhem around his house.  Of course if you had two much bigger older brothers covering your back, you'd probably have a little attitude you.

So I take Moki and his brothers for long leash walks.  Twice now Moki has decided to bring along a toy, because just keeping up with the big boys isn't enough work.  Now the toy Moki likes to carry is a "Kong".   And it is actually the same size of his head.  He carries it's smaller end in his mouth...for the entire walk.  Never setting it down, never resting.  This is not some light little toy.  Kongs are designed to be "chew proof" so they are made of really heavy rubber.  Moki is definitely one of the most determined, single minded dogs I have ever worked with.  He is a true warrior.
